Key Features to Look For
When shopping, check these important features first. These make a big difference in how the lights work and look.
Brightness and Color Temperature
- Lumens: This measures how bright the light is. For kitchens, you usually want brighter light for tasks. Look for lights around 300-500 lumens per section.
- Color Temperature (Kelvin – K): This tells you if the light looks warm (yellowish) or cool (bluish).
- 2700K – 3000K: This is a warm, cozy light, great for living areas.
- 3500K – 4500K: This is a neutral or bright white, perfect for food prep in the kitchen.

Important Materials and Build Quality
The materials used affect how long your lights last and how they look installed.
Fixture Material
- Aluminum: Most good quality light bars use aluminum. Aluminum helps keep the LEDs cool, which makes them last longer. It also looks sleek.
- Plastic: Cheaper options sometimes use plastic. Plastic can sometimes yellow over time or feel less sturdy.
Light Source Durability
LEDs are the light source. Look for a high CRI (Color Rendering Index) score, ideally 80 or higher. A high CRI means the colors of your food and countertops look true to life under the light.

Installation Ease
Most under counter lights use adhesive tape or small screws for mounting. Easy-to-install kits save you time. Look for kits that come with simple connectors so you do not need an electrician.
Power Source
- Plug-in (AC Adapter): These are very simple to set up. You plug them into a wall outlet. The downside is you might see the cord.
- Battery Powered: These are great for renters or areas far from an outlet. However, you must change or recharge the batteries often.
- Hardwired: These connect directly to your home’s electrical system. They look the cleanest but usually need professional installation.
Heat Output
A major benefit of LEDs is they produce very little heat. Poorly made lights might still get hot. Excessive heat reduces the lifespan of the LED chips.

10 Frequently Asked Questions (FAQ) About LED Under Counter Lights
Q: How long do LED under counter lights usually last?
A: Good quality LED lights often last 25,000 to 50,000 hours. This means they can work for many years without needing replacement.
Q: Do I need an electrician to install these lights?
A: Most popular plug-in or battery-operated kits do not need an electrician. They are designed for simple DIY installation.
Q: What is the difference between strip lights and puck lights?
A: Strip lights are long, flexible strips that give continuous light. Puck lights are small, round fixtures that give focused spots of light.
Q: Can I connect different sets of lights together?
A: Yes, many modular systems let you link several light bars or pucks together using small connectors.
Q: Will under counter lights make my kitchen look too blue?
A: No, not if you choose the right color temperature. Look for 3000K for a pleasant white light, or higher if you prefer a crisp, daylight look.
Q: Are LED under counter lights energy efficient?
A: Yes, they use much less electricity than old halogen or fluorescent lights. This saves money on your power bill.
Q: What if the adhesive tape fails?
A: If the included tape fails, you can usually secure the lights using small screws, especially if they are aluminum fixtures.
Q: Can I cut LED strip lights?
A: Some LED strips allow you to cut them at marked lines. Always check the product instructions before cutting any strip.
Q: Should I choose lights that are warm or cool white for food prep?
A: Cool or neutral white light (around 4000K) is generally better for food prep because it makes colors appear clearer and brighter.
Q: Are these lights waterproof?
A: Most indoor under counter lights are not waterproof. They should only be used in dry areas. If you need them near water, look for an IP rating that indicates water resistance.
